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92958509 25821 3125017 918 56319
265646 78892
265646 78892
80379562936 1889430 388 480 06
All about undefined
Interested in learning more?
265646 78892
80379562936 1889430 388 480 06
See more
93319 31
643120453 56701 0576
See more
11 5446 28548132872
62898203 183 97 35742
See more